About Debashis De

Debashis De is a scholar working on Electrical and Electronic Engineering, Computer Networks and Communications, Computational Theory and Mathematics, Atomic and Molecular Physics, and Optics and Biomedical Engineering, having authored 439 papers that have together received 5.5k indexed citations. Recurring topics across this work include Quantum-Dot Cellular Automata (108 papers), Advanced Memory and Neural Computing (77 papers), IoT and Edge/Fog Computing (66 papers), Quantum and electron transport phenomena (48 papers), Advancements in Semiconductor Devices and Circuit Design (47 papers), Advanced MIMO Systems Optimization (35 papers), Energy Efficient Wireless Sensor Networks (35 papers) and Semiconductor materials and devices (27 papers). The work is most often cited by research in Computational Theory and Mathematics (1.4k citations), Computer Networks and Communications (1.7k citations), Electrical and Electronic Engineering (2.9k citations), Information Systems (555 citations) and Computer Vision and Pattern Recognition (426 citations). Debashis De has collaborated with scholars based in India, Australia and United States. Frequent co-authors include Jadav Chandra Das, Anwesha Mukherjee, Nurzaman Ahmed, Md. Iftekhar Hussain, Dinesh Dash, Partha Pratim Ray, Manash Chanda, Amit Bhattacharyya, Kunal Das and Deepsubhra Guha Roy. Their work appears in journals such as Microsystem Technologies, Wireless Personal Communications, IET Nanobiotechnology, Nano Communication Networks and IEEE Access.
